Output 28d29e2e0d9306e7e95defbeb0cdff4a89e59ce1edbf0f72786170d526d24962:19

value
26935867
script pubkey
OP_0 OP_PUSHBYTES_32 c4dc56b02b6435c8b18e70b3b0ca30a54b91185f7704b6c526fe83c17c764b4d
address
bc1qcnw9dvptvs6u3vvwwzempj3s549ezxzlwuztd3fxl6puzlrkfdxs425q6q
transaction
28d29e2e0d9306e7e95defbeb0cdff4a89e59ce1edbf0f72786170d526d24962
spent
true